Job description

ROLE STATEMENT

The Shop Mechanic will be a member of the Repair and Maintenance department responsible for the repair and maintenance of hydraulic fracturing (including trucks, frac pumps, blenders, hydration units) using hand and/or power tools and following oral and written work orders. Reporting to the Maintenance Manager, the Shop Mechanic will focus on adhering to Calfrac Well Services operational, safety and environmental policies and procedures at all times.

SCHEDULE

10 days on, 4 days off (12 hour days)

SPECIFIC ACCOUNTABILITIES
  • Provide effective communication with management in the District regarding operations and continuous improvement initiatives
  • Able to participate in the development of policies and procedures to meet operational service line requirements
  • Work with all operations groups, i.e. Sales & Marketing, Engineering, Human Resources, etc. to ensure a trouble free operation
  • Manage employee and equipment assignments and schedules to meet customer requirements to achieve corporate mandate of “Service First”.
  • Ensure adherence to operational policies, procedures to achieve safety objectives.
  • Meet and inspires others to meet the Corporate Code of Business ethics
  • Maintain Calfrac safety standards at all times, including a clean work environment
  • Preventive Maintenance – inspecting equipment for leaks, checking fluids/gauges, cleaning/lubricating parts, inspecting hoses & clamps, frames and crossmembers
  • Troubleshooting malfunctions on all mobile and fixed mounted pressure pumping equipment, including hydraulic and electrical systems, diesel engines, and automatic transmissions
  • Disassemble equipment to remove parts and make repairs
  • Repair, replace, adjust, and align components of equipment
  • Test repaired equipment to verify adequacy of repairs
  • Operate equipment and communicate/display proper operation to others
  • Various other duties as assigned
